Course Highlights

  • Machine Familiarization: Gain a deep understanding of different types of industrial sewing machines, their components, and their unique capabilities. Learn to identify and select the right machine for various sewing tasks.
  • Safety Protocols: Prioritize safety with hands-on instruction on the safe operation of industrial sewing machines, including proper machine setup, maintenance, and personal safety measures.
  • Threading and Bobbin Winding: Master the art of threading industrial machines, including winding bobbins correctly to ensure smooth and efficient sewing.
  • Stitch Length: Explore the different stitch lengths available on an industrial sewing machine and which ones are suitable for different seam applications.
  • Speed and Precision: Hone your skills in controlling stitching speed and maintaining precise seam allowances, vital for professional-quality sewing.
  • Fabric Handling: Learn essential techniques for handling different types of fabrics and materials, ensuring optimal results and preventing damage to the machine.
  • Troubleshooting: Develop problem-solving skills to address common sewing machine issues and perform basic maintenance to keep the machine in peak condition.
